Scholarship overview
The goal of the scholarship is to support applicants who demonstrate a commitment to community engagement and collaborative, team-based service, while also easing the financial burden students may experience during an away rotation. Students interested in pursuing a career in one of the following specialties are eligible to apply: Dermatology, Diagnostic Radiology, Emergency Medicine, Family Medicine, General Surgery, Internal Medicine, Obstetrics & Gynecology, Orthopedic Surgery, Pathology, or Physical Medicine & Rehabilitation. One scholarship award of up to $1,500 will be available for each specialty to support a rotation at Baylor University Medical Center or Baylor Scott and White Medical Center-Waxahachie between July and January.
Who should apply
Senior medical students entering the current year’s match that are from LCME or AOA-accredited medical schools within the United States and Puerto Rico but whose home institution is outside of the Dallas-Fort Worth metroplex are welcome to apply. Students must first submit a rotation application through the Association of American Medical Colleges' (AAMC) Visiting Student Learning Opportunities (VSLO) site. Senior students from Texas A&M Health Science Center Vashisht College of Medicine that are not assigned to Dallas as their home campus may apply after they have been scheduled to a visiting elective associated with the residency they intend to match into.
